Every legion got everyone. There is a way to fit pretty much any niche into any legion.

>But muh recruitment sites!
Fuck Terrans. With very VERY few exceptions, every legion picked up more than a handful of companies of marines from places other than their primarch's homeworld. Either for reinforcements, reserves, or specialists, additional marines were picked up from conquered worlds, protectorate worlds, legion resupply worlds, void-colonies, and pretty much anyone else a legion could get their hands on. Don't ever feel limited by the primarch's homeworld, and Terra.

They were bloodthirsty, but they weren't Celts. They didn't run at you from across a field. Surprise and shock were always key facets of their warfare. Using the bush to move in as close as possible, and then with a scream and a roar hitting their foes hard and fast before they could react.

You might want to read ' Bush fighting : illustrated by remarkable actions and incidents of the Māori War in New Zealand' by James Edward Alexander. He fought in the New Zealand Wars and knew their ambush skills well.
